(defvar gnus-group-topics '(("no" "^no" nil) ("misc" "." nil)) "*Alist of newsgroup topics. This alist has entries of the form (TOPIC REGEXP SHOW) where TOPIC is the name of the topic a group is put in if it matches REGEXP. A group can only be in one topic at a time. If SHOW is nil, newsgroups will be inserted according to `gnus-group-topic-topics-only', otherwise that variable is ignored and the groups are always shown if SHOW is true or never if SHOW is a number.")
